The Rise of Mini Bags in Fashion Trends

Understanding the Popularity Surge

Mini bags have taken the fashion world by storm. Their compact size and stylish appeal make them perfect for any occasion. In Australia, these tiny treasures have become a staple accessory. Fashion-conscious Aussies love their practicality and chic look. The trend has grown rapidly, with more people opting for smaller, more manageable bags. Social media has played a big role in this surge. Influencers and celebrities showcase their mini bags, sparking desire among followers. The minimalist lifestyle trend has also contributed to their popularity. People are choosing to carry less and focus on essentials. This shift aligns perfectly with the mini bag concept.

The Versatility of Mini Bags in Everyday Fashion

Mini bags are incredibly versatile. They can complement any outfit, from casual to formal. For a day out shopping, a colorful mini bag adds a pop of fun. At a fancy dinner, a sleek, metallic mini bag elevates the entire look. They're perfect for music festivals, where hands-free movement is key. Office-goers appreciate their professional yet trendy appearance. Mini bags can hold essentials like phones, cards, and keys without bulk. This makes them ideal for quick errands or nights out. Their small size forces users to declutter and carry only what's necessary. This aligns well with the modern, minimalist lifestyle many Australians embrace.

Crafting the Perfect Mini Bag

Key Considerations for Design and Manufacturing

Designing the perfect mini bag requires careful planning. Manufacturers must balance style with functionality. The size is crucial - it should be small yet able to hold essentials. Shape variety is important to cater to different tastes. Some prefer structured designs, while others like soft, flexible bags. Closure mechanisms need to be secure yet easy to use. Zippers, magnetic snaps, or fold-over flaps are popular choices. Strap options are another key factor. Designers often include removable or adjustable straps. This allows users to wear the bag in multiple ways. Color selection is vital in appealing to the Australian market. Bold hues and neutrals both have their place in the mini bag world.

Material Selection for Durability and Style

Choosing the right materials is crucial for mini bag success. Leather remains a popular choice for its durability and luxe feel. Vegan leather options cater to eco-conscious consumers. Canvas and nylon offer lightweight, casual alternatives. For evening wear, satin, sequins, and beaded materials shine. Weather-resistant materials are important in Australia's varied climate. Sturdy hardware like metal clasps and zippers ensure longevity. Some brands experiment with unique materials like cork or recycled plastics. This appeals to environmentally aware customers. The material must withstand daily use while maintaining its shape. Quality lining protects the bag's contents and adds to its overall value.

The Importance of Functionality in Mini Bags

Despite their small size, mini bags must be functional. Smart interior organization is key to maximizing space. Multiple pockets help separate items like cards, cash, and makeup. Some designs include a detachable card holder for added convenience. External pockets can provide quick access to phones or keys. Adjustable straps allow for versatile wearing options. Cross-body, shoulder, or wrist strap styles suit different needs. Some mini bags come with a top handle for easy grabbing. Water-resistant compartments protect valuables from unexpected rain. Lightweight design ensures the bag doesn't become a burden. Balancing these functional elements with aesthetic appeal is crucial.

Analyzing the Demographics of Mini Bag Consumers

Understanding the mini bag consumer is crucial for market success. In Australia, young adults aged 18-35 are the primary buyers. They value style and practicality in their accessories. Urban dwellers particularly appreciate mini bags for their convenience. Fashion-forward professionals use them to elevate work outfits. Students like mini bags for their lightweight, compact nature. Middle-aged consumers are also embracing the trend for evening events. Higher-income groups tend to invest in luxury mini bag brands. Budget-conscious shoppers look for affordable yet stylish options. Eco-friendly consumers seek sustainable materials and ethical production. Understanding these demographics helps tailor products and marketing strategies.
